话不多说,先看三维结果:我这里用的COMSOL版本为5.6版本,不同版本差异很小。第1步:构建几何:我这里建立一个圆柱和一个长方体,圆柱在长方体上运动,尺寸大家随意设置。 第2步:添加物理场:第3步:添加条件:这一步最关键的,也是困扰了我好久的地方!             指定变形、自由变形、指定网格位移、零法向量
接触COMSOL也有一年时间了,相信很多朋友都有这样的感触,那就是完全不知所措,无从下手。根据网上的一些经验,参考案例,看用户手册,折腾了几个月甚至大半年的时间,对于模型计算的各种错误一头雾水,完全不知所云,胡乱的瞎改,盲目的调试,在电脑前一坐就是一小天,茶饭不思,那叫一个折磨。甚至有几天下定决心要翻译用户手册,因为有关COMSOL的教程或者知识实在少的可怜。不过,对于我个人研究方向的模型,经历
以一个算例来谈——On/Off Control of a Thermal Actuator。先阐述物理背景,这是一个MEMS领域里的热执行器,作用就是通过焦耳热使多晶硅材料的热臂发生结构变形,从而产生特定范围内的位移得到控制的目的。此模型有三种物理场的耦合,电流、固体传热和固体力学,三种物理场的边界条件发别如下图所示。后面谈此算例comsol部分和simulink部分主要的一些重点难点。
本文所述适用于COMSOL Multiphysics 5.5和MATLAB2019a联合仿真1 启动条件想要MATLAB可以和COMSOL联合仿真,最基本的要求就是安装COMSOL时将其和MATLAB联合的方式选定到MATLAB安装的文件夹。这样会生成一个COMSOL Multiphysics 5.5 with MATLAB。 直接打开COMSOL Multiphysics 5.5 with MA
转载 2024-06-12 21:19:19
375阅读
问题描述 我打算购买一台专用于运行 COMSOL Multiphysics® 的计算机,请求推荐硬件配置。 解决方法COMSOL Multiphysics® 求解的问题类型相当广泛,加之当今软件和硬件开发速度之快,并且不同价位的硬件有着很大的差异,因此,我们不能一概而论地说哪一款计算机对于所有使用案例来说都是最佳选择。内存对于计算机而言,最重要一个因素,要有足够的物理内存 (RAM)
**首先就是配置环境,** 不建议在windows下使用强化学习,也不建议使用虚拟机跑上述这些包,因为虚拟机很难调用GPU。会影响后期使用,在windows挣扎很久后决定还Linux。 最好使用linux系统进行处理 当前环境为windows10+ubuntu20.04双系统 使用的mujoco为210版本,好在openai刚收购了mujoco,可以免费使用,暂时没有使用mujoco150版本。博
初学者对于comsol一开始怎么学习怎么入门,从哪方面入手等不是很清楚,自己盲目的学习有时候会浪费很多时间,可能效果一般,下面comsol的仿真案例及软件的基本操作方向,初学的同学可以参考以下内容COMSOL 仿真实践(RF 及波动光学模块案例 Step by step 详解):1、光子晶体能带分析、能谱计算、光纤模态计算、微腔腔膜求解;2、类比凝聚态领域魔角石墨烯的 moiré 光子晶体建模以
文章目录程序源代码 联系企鹅号 3270516346一、计算机系统概述1、设计内容2、计算机的基本硬件组成3、指令执行的各个阶段二、指令系统设计1、指令格式2、CPU寄存器3、设计的指令及功能4、10个数累加并求平均数的指令设计三、模块详细设计1、寄存器模块设计①程序计数器设计(PC)②次地址计算单元(NPC)③指令寄存器(IM)④寄存器堆(RF)⑤数据存储器(DM)2、算数逻辑单元(ALU)3、
薛定谔-泊松方程多物理场接口可用于模拟量子阱、量子线和量子点等量子约束系统中的载流子。在本文中,我们将以砷化镓纳米线的基准模型为例,演示如何使用 COMSOL Multiphysics® 软件附加的“半导体模块”提供的这项功能。薛定谔-泊松方程多物理场接口自 COMSOL Multiphysics® 5.4 版本起,用户可以使用全新的薛定谔-泊松方程多物理场接口,在静电接口和薛定谔方程接口之间创建
# COMSOL与Python的结合使用 ## 引言 COMSOL Multiphysics 一个强大的多物理场仿真软件,可以用来解决各种工程和科学问题。使用内置的图形用户界面,用户可以方便地进行前处理、求解和后处理。然而,许多用户希望利用 Python 的灵活性和强大功能与 COMSOL 进行交互,从而提高工作效率。本文将探讨如何在 COMSOL调用 Python,实现自动化和高级计算
原创 2024-10-25 04:07:23
66阅读
# Python调用COMSOL ## 介绍 COMSOL Multiphysics一款强大的多物理场建模和仿真软件,可用于解决各种工程和科学问题。COMSOL提供了一个[COMSOL LiveLink]( 本文将介绍如何使用Python调用COMSOL,并通过一个简单的示例来说明其用法。 ## 安装COMSOL 首先,您需要安装COMSOL Multiphysics软件。请访问[CO
原创 2023-07-31 11:14:45
809阅读
comsol 学习1新建几何绘制添加材料添加物理场 新建选择“三维” 双击选择对应的物理场 选择“稳态”几何绘制定义特定参数构建多边形点击矩形,在右边图形中绘制一个矩形–点击布尔操作中差集-点击激活(要添加的对象)-选择多边形–点击激活(要减去的对象)-选择矩形-点击构建选定对象。点击工作平面-拉伸-修改指定距离选择圆柱体-修改高度与半径-修改位置 并进行差集添加材料默认将几何中的所有域都添加上
转载 2023-12-22 22:56:06
334阅读
Part I : 平面四边形等差单元理论部分:平面四边形等差单元 由矩形单元 作等参变换(坐标映射)而来。四边形等参单元的刚度矩阵二重积分式,我想用Maple求解析解,算了很久也没有算出结果。所有我的编程思路先用 sympy 求出 单元刚度矩阵的符号解,再用lambdify函数将符号解的单元刚度矩阵的各元素转为普通的python函数,最后用scipy进行二重数值积分。 Part
转载 2023-02-14 14:44:24
1153阅读
目录1.comsol底层是什么语言2.要开发一个和comsol类似的多物理场仿真软件需要哪些平台或者语言3.开发计划4.短期计划5.一年内计划:1.comsol底层是什么语言COMSOL Multiphysics底层采用了多种编程语言实现,具体包括:C++:COMSOL Multiphysics的底层核心使用C++编写。C++一种快速、高效、强类型的编程语言,被广泛应用于系统级编程和大型软件开发
在仿真的时候添加适当的物理场,在系统中添加载荷及约束。添加物理场这里添加的都是单接口的物理场。 这是一个支架热应力分析教学案例。 我们需要定义一个热物理场(这个定义过程通用)添加物理场确定你的模型应用于哪个物理领域。如果你选择创建模型向导来创建模型的时候,这一步已经在选择物理场中选择完了 如果创建空模型进入的,在点击添加物理场后,从右侧选择你要添加的场。 添加后就可以在左侧功能树下见到,一个物理
现代光学系统通常需要在恶劣的环境中运行,包括高海拔、太空、水下以及激光和核设施中,并且往往需要承受结构载荷和极端温度。 通过数值模拟进行结构-热-光学性能(structural-thermal-optical performance ,STOP)分析获取所有这些环境影响最便捷的方法。STOP 分析典型的多物理场问题,在本篇文章中,我们将通过一个案例模型介绍如何使用 COMSOL
COMSOL光电仿真 新手学习需要注意的点通过模块详解掌握各种边界条件和域条件的设置方法和技巧,区分每个边界条件或域条件应该在什么场景中应用。掌握精确仿真电磁场所需的网格划分标准及优化技巧,深入探索从模拟中获得的结果(如分析设计方案中的电磁场分布、功率损耗、传输和反射、阻抗和品质因子等),对光子器件、集成光路、光波导、耦合器、光纤等设计进行优化。应用COMSOL WITH MATLAB 进行复杂物
# 利用Python调用COMSOL进行多物理场模拟 COMSOL Multiphysics一款广泛应用于工程、物理等领域的多物理场模拟软件。它的强大之处在于能够便捷地进行复杂的物理现象仿真,如热传导、流体动力学、电磁场等。为了提高工作效率,很多用户选择使用Python语言与COMSOL进行交互。本文将详细介绍如何利用Python调用COMSOL,并附带代码示例。 ## 1. 环境搭建 要
原创 2024-09-10 04:44:01
372阅读
# Python如何调用COMSOL COMSOL一种用于多物理场建模和仿真的软件平台。它提供了一个灵活的用户界面和一系列强大的求解器,可以用于研究和设计各种物理现象。COMSOL可以通过COM接口与其他程序进行集成,包括Python。在本文中,我们将介绍如何使用Python调用COMSOL。 ## 步骤一:安装COMSOL和Python 首先,我们需要安装COMSOL和Python。请确
原创 2023-08-10 18:43:15
3109阅读
1点赞
1、COMSOL只是一款“界面非常友善” “功能比较完善”的偏微分方程(PDE)求解器!虽然COMSOL多物理场耦合计算软件。但它相比其他软件的优点:有中文版,功能齐全,界面友善。完全适用于习惯了windows操作系统的广大群众。但无论叫它什么,它的本质都是“求解器”而已。进行数值建模或数值仿真,需要考虑三大步骤:前处理,求解,后处理。而COMSOL集成了这三大步骤。所有的设置都可以在同一个操
  • 1
  • 2
  • 3
  • 4
  • 5